neutral about
Frequency: 6.99.5 per million words
Used to specify the subject or issue towards which one is neutral.

Examples (10)
- The committee tried to remain neutral about the controversial proposal.
- It's difficult for a judge to be completely neutral about cases involving children.
- Many voters feel neutral about the upcoming election results.
- She stated that she was neutral about the new company policy.
- The organization claims to be neutral about political affiliations.
- As an observer, he must stay neutral about the ongoing discussions.
- Are you really neutral about whether we go to the beach or the mountains?
- Historians aim to be neutral about past events, presenting only facts.
- I'm quite neutral about trying new restaurants; I don't have a strong preference.
- Their official stance is to be neutral about the international conflict.
